A box plot, also known as a boxplot, is a method in descriptive statistics for graphically demonstrating the locality, spread, and skewness groups of numerical data through their quartiles.
A box plot is made up of five values: the smallest, first quartile, median, third quartile, and maximum value. These values are used to compare how close other data values are to them.

What is the Assimilation in Paigetian Concept?
Assimilation is a term that describes how humans comprehend and adjust to new information.
<u>Assimilation</u> occurs when individuals try to adjust new information into pre-existing cognitive schemas.
This implies that <u>Assimilation</u> occurs individuals encounter new or unusual information and utilize the past learned information to understand it.
